Title of article :
Cooperative assembly of coexistent lanthanide–carboxylate chain and layer in a (4,6)-connected network

Abstract :
A novel 3D praseodymium metal–organic framework, [Pr2L4(H2O)2]2n·nH2O, in which the 2D layers constructed by the interweaving right- and left-handed helical lanthanide–carboxylate chains are further pillared by 1D lanthanide–carboxylate chains, has been hydrothermally synthesized employing flexible 3-(4-(carboxymethoxy) phenyl) propanoic acid (H2L) as organic ligand. Its structure presents a new (4,6)-connected topology with a Schläfli symbol of {43.63}{44.62}2{47.64.84}{48.66.8}. This complex exhibits intense characteristic emission bands of Pr3 + ions in the solid state at room temperature.
